Lines Matching defs:sent
121 struct sent
123 struct sent *next;
126 } *slist, **slisttail, *sent, *nsent;
227 if ((sent = (struct sent *)malloc(sizeof(struct sent))) == 0)
229 sent->next = 0;
230 sent->name = SaveStr(name);
231 sent->mode = mode;
232 *slisttail = sent;
233 slisttail = &sent->next;
245 sent->mode = -3;
260 sent->mode = -1;
265 sent->mode = -2;
301 firstn = sent->name;
325 for (sent = slist; sent; sent = sent->next)
327 switch (sent->mode)
330 printf("\t%s\t(Attached)\n", sent->name);
333 printf("\t%s\t(Detached)\n", sent->name);
337 printf("\t%s\t(Multi, attached)\n", sent->name);
340 printf("\t%s\t(Multi, detached)\n", sent->name);
345 printf("\t%s\t(Dead ?%c?)\n", sent->name, '?');
348 printf("\t%s\t(Removed)\n", sent->name);
351 printf("\t%s\t(Remote or dead)\n", sent->name);
354 printf("\t%s\t(Private)\n", sent->name);
374 for (sent = slist; sent; sent = nsent)
376 nsent = sent->next;
377 free(sent->name);
378 free((char *)sent);